Welcome to the Torvale pop-up office at the Greymarsh Expo! Team assistants, you're the glue holding this stand together. Our little cabin behind Hall C has the spare lanyards, the coffee machine, and the lockable cupboard with demo units — please keep it shut whenever you step away. The cabin door locks automatically, and fair security won't let you back in without credentials. To get in during setup and show hours, use the pass code below.

door code, kawip-bagap: bdg-HQEWH-4

Subject: DR drill — Memtrace GPU profiler

Team,

Thursday's disaster-recovery drill will simulate loss of the Memtrace profiling cluster. We'll restore allocation snapshots from cold storage and verify the kernel-trace pipeline end to end. Expect roughly two hours of degraded profiling. Restoring the snapshot archive requires unsealing the backup vault, which prompts for the recovery passphrase. For the drill, that passphrase is recorded below.

recovery phrase for bawef-kagug: casix-tamvan-lamath-holeth-gilmir-drudor-julax-wenok-wenael-rusvan-holax-goriel-frawyn

Leadership Review Briefing — Marketing Spend

Quick heads-up before Thursday's session: we're trimming the marketing budget at Harlowe & Finch by roughly 18% for the second half. The Brightmere campaign wraps early, and regional print ads are paused across the Kettleford branches. Digital spend stays mostly intact, so don't panic — leads shouldn't dip much. Branch managers should hold off on any new local sponsorships until the review lands. Before you brief your teams, read the note below carefully.

board note of tadup-tajog: Headcount on the Oliiel team goes from 31 to 88 by the end of February. Gross margin on Oliiel came in at 62 percent against a plan of 29 percent.